Autore Topic: Problema con TableLayout  (Letto 472 volte)

Offline Christian Giupponi

  • Utente junior
  • **
  • Post: 128
  • Respect: 0
    • Google+
    • http://it.linkedin.com/pub/christian-giupponi/29/628/810
    • ultimoprofeta
    • Mostra profilo
  • Dispositivo Android:
    Galaxy Nexus
  • Play Store ID:
    ItalianDevTeam
  • Sistema operativo:
    Mac OSX Lion
Problema con TableLayout
« il: 28 Maggio 2011, 19:17:50 CEST »
0
Ciao a tutti,
ho un problema alquanti insolito...praticamente ho la necessità di avere sullo schermo una mia tastiera e per questo motivo ho replicato la tastiera inserendo solo le lettere e mantenendo l'ordine del layout qwerty.
Sull'emulatore non ho avuto nessun problema ma appena ho installato l'applicazione sul mio Desire HD (che ha uno schermo tutto sommato abbastanza largo) alcune lettere (in particolare la W e la P) risultavano essere fuori dallo schermo.
Pensavo fosse un problema di larghezza della Tabella ma ho impostato l'attributo android:layout_width a "fill_parent" e quindi non capisco come sia possibile questo problema :S

Questi sono gli attributi della TableLayout
Codice (XML): [Seleziona]
<TableLayout
        android:id="@+id/tablellaEsterna"
        xmlns:android="http://schemas.android.com/apk/res/android"
        android:layout_width="fill_parent"
        android:layout_height="fill_parent"
        android:layout_marginTop="20dp">

e per sicurezza ho impostato anche ogni TableRow in questo modo:

Codice (XML): [Seleziona]
<TableRow
                android:id="@+id/riga1"
                android:layout_width="fill_parent"
                android:layout_height="wrap_content"
                android:gravity="center_horizontal">

I tasti che mostro non sono altro che semplici Button che hanno come valore la lettera della tastiera:

Codice (XML): [Seleziona]
<Button
                        android:id="@+id/btnTasto1"
                        android:layout_height="wrap_content"
                        android:layout_width="wrap_content"
                        android:text="Q"
                        android:onClick="LetteraQ"
                />

Sapete dirmi cosa sbaglio?

Offline JD

  • Amministratore
  • Utente storico
  • *****
  • Post: 1600
  • Respect: +232
    • leinardi
    • Mostra profilo
  • Dispositivo Android:
    LG Nexus 5
  • Sistema operativo:
    L'ultima Ubuntu
Re:Problema con TableLayout
« Risposta #1 il: 04 Giugno 2011, 16:24:02 CEST »
0
Posta l'XML completo ;)
È stata trovata una soluzione al tuo problema?
Evidenzia il post più utile premendo . È un ottimo modo per ringraziare chi ti ha aiutato ;).
E se hai aperto tu il thread marcalo come risolto cliccando !